The Orphan: Or Comfort And Counsel To The Fatherless And The Motherless (1867) is a book written by William P. Nimmo Publisher. This book is a guide for orphans who have lost one or both of their parents, providing them with comfort and advice on how to navigate life without their parents. The book covers a range of topics, including the importance of faith, the value of hard work, and the need for self-reliance. It also offers practical advice on how to manage finances, build relationships, and find a sense of purpose in life.
